-Sub-order of the Foraminifera group. -Unicellular animal ranging in size from 0.1-8mm.
-Benthonic or planktonic forms with a considerable disparity in morphology within the suborder. |
| -Only extinct suborder of Foraminifera. -Peaked in number in Early Carboniferous, already in prolonged decline throughout Permian. -Already 90% extinct by P-T boundary, but last 10% was finished off by extinction event. -Only fossils found in Triassic beds are derived from underlying beds. |
